    Robin Uthappa: Dhoni’s CSK Future and IPL Transition

    Former Chennai Super Kings stalwart Robin Uthappa has expressed his belief that MS Dhoni’s departure from CSK and the IPL is imminent and, more importantly, that the current juncture is the most appropriate time for it. Uthappa emphasizes that the franchise is already deeply immersed in a transition period, making Dhoni’s exit a logical next step.

    Uthappa elaborated on his assessment, explaining that Dhoni’s direct involvement and leadership roles within the CSK setup have seen a consistent decline over the years. He specifically referenced the period when Dhoni reclaimed the captaincy from Ravindra Jadeja, noting that leadership authority has been systematically transferred to Ruturaj Gaikwad with each subsequent season.

    “His role hasn’t dramatically changed because this transition has been in progress for some time,” Uthappa noted. “Ever since the captaincy was passed back to him from Ravindra Jadeja, you could observe the responsibilities shifting annually. More and more has moved towards Ruturaj Gaikwad each season. Given the current state of the squad, it truly feels like the right moment for Dhoni to step away.”

    CSK has demonstrated its confidence in Ruturaj Gaikwad as their long-term captaincy choice. Despite a difficult inaugural season for Gaikwad as skipper, which saw the team miss the playoffs, and a mid-tournament elbow fracture in IPL 2025 that sidelined him, the franchise appears steadfast in its support. Gaikwad’s absence had a substantial negative effect on the team’s performance, leading to CSK’s unprecedented finish at the bottom of the league standings in IPL 2025.

    Signs pointing towards a leadership evolution at CSK have become increasingly visible. While Dhoni has been the undisputed core of the franchise for approximately 18 seasons, the team’s management is clearly preparing for a future without his on-field presence. This strategic foresight was further highlighted by the trade for Sanju Samson, who is widely expected to take over the wicketkeeping duties following Dhoni’s eventual retirement. Complementing the focus on future leadership, CSK also made significant strategic acquisitions at the IPL 2026 mini-auction, heavily investing in promising uncapped Indian talent. The franchise secured Prashant Veer and Kartik Sharma for substantial sums of Rs 14.2 crore each. Veer is viewed as a potential successor to Ravindra Jadeja, owing to his proficiency as a left-arm spinner and a left-handed batter. Kartik Sharma, regarded as one of the most talented young wicketkeeper-batsmen in the domestic circuit, also attracted considerable interest from multiple IPL teams.

    It remains to be seen how effectively these young talents will perform and justify the significant investment as the tournament unfolds.
